About Deeragun

Deeragun is a growing residential suburb located 17 kilometres northwest of Townsville's CBD in the Thuringowa district. With a population of around 4,300 residents, it forms part of the expanding northern corridor alongside neighbouring Burdell and Bushland Beach. The suburb features newer housing estates offering quality homes on generous block sizes, popular with families seeking space and value.

The suburb provides a relaxed lifestyle with easy access to shopping, schools, and recreational facilities. A Coles supermarket, police station, community hall, and Woodlands Skate Park serve local needs, with additional retail nearby in Burdell. Deeragun attracts families and first-home buyers who appreciate the affordable housing, proximity to beaches at Bushland Beach, and easy highway access to Townsville CBD and the airport.

Deeragun falls under postcode 4818 and is governed by Townsville Council (LGA). For state elections, residents vote in the Hinchinbrook electorate.
